Output 59d6cb247fd40973a669bb62aa085a28db404102431e80f26948aa4888835825:0

value
17503289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ef17ac8fc28ac8c59d1bc46cb50a8cd96aebdb5e OP_EQUAL
address
MVhN6BSQNfMHVytY1Z48m1BHBq7Ym6mfRP
transaction
59d6cb247fd40973a669bb62aa085a28db404102431e80f26948aa4888835825
spent
true